Classification of magnetic materials

Classification of magnetic materials

2021-10-11

Magnetic materials are mainly divided into hard magnetic and soft magnetic.


Hard magnetic material: is a material that can still have magnetism after the magnetization field is removed; soft magnetic material is a material that has a high magnetic induction intensity when the magnetization field is present, and loses its magnetism when the magnetization field is removed. The hard and soft here do not refer to the hard and soft in mechanical properties, but the hard and soft in magnetic properties. Hard magnetic means that the magnetic material can retain its strong magnetism (referred to as magnetism) for a long time after being magnetized by an external magnetic field, and it is characterized by high coercivity. Coercive force is the magnetic field strength that reduces the residual magnetism (residual magnetic flux density or residual magnetization) to zero after the magnetic material is magnetized and then demagnetized. The soft magnetic material is a magnetic material that is easy to magnetize and demagnetize by applying a magnetic field, that is, a magnetic material with very low coercivity. Demagnetization means that after applying a magnetic field (called a magnetization field) to magnetize a magnetic material, a magnetic field that is opposite to the direction of the magnetization field is added to reduce the magnetic field.


Soft magnetic materials: Soft magnetic materials can be roughly divided into four categories.


① Alloy thin strip or sheet: FeNi(Mo), FeSi, FeAl, etc.


②Amorphous alloy ribbon: Fe-based, Co-based, FeNi-based or FeNiCo-based, etc., with appropriate Si, B, P and other doping elements, also known as magnetic glass.


③Magnetic medium (iron powder core): FeNi(Mo), FeSiAl, carbonyl iron, ferrite and other powder materials, which are coated and bonded by an electrical insulating medium, and then pressed into shape as required.


④Ferrite: including spinel type──MO·Fe2O3 (M stands for NiZn, MnZn, MgZn, Li1/2Fe1/2Zn, CaZn, etc.), magnetoplumbite type─Ba3Me2Fe24O41 (Me stands for Co, Ni, Mg, Zn, etc.) , Cu and its composite components).


Soft magnetic materials are widely used, mainly for high-frequency acceleration of magnetic antennas, inductors, transformers, magnetic heads, earphones, relays, vibrators, TV deflection yokes, cables, delay lines, sensors, microwave absorbing materials, electromagnets, and accelerators Cavity, magnetic field probe, magnetic substrate, magnetic field shielding, high-frequency quenching energy accumulation, electromagnetic chuck, magnetic sensitive element (such as magnetocaloric material as switch), etc.
